Do I need a contract for renting a room?

Whatever the type of property you let it’s always advisable to have the right tenancy agreement in place. This will protect both tenant and landlord and, in many cases, it’s a legal requirement to have a contract.

How do I write a room rental agreement?

Key details included in a standard rent agreement are:

  1. Names and addresses of the tenant and the landlord.
  2. Signatures of the tenant and the landlord.
  3. Monthly rental amount.
  4. Security deposit.
  5. Maintenance charges.
  6. Period of stay.
  7. Responsibilities/rights of the landlord.
  8. Responsibilities/rights of the tenant.

What is renting a room in a house called?

In California, a person who rents a room in a house is known as a lodger. State landlord-tenant laws apply to a room you are renting, regardless of whether you signed a lease.

Can you let family live in your house rent free?

A Yes, you can let your daughter live rent free, but there are tax implications. Strictly speaking, the tax rules say you cannot deduct any expenses on property let uncommercially – whether it is rent free or at below-market rent.

What happens if you get caught renting your house?

You could be sent to prison for 5 years or get an unlimited fine for renting property in England to someone who you knew or had ‘reasonable cause to believe’ did not have the right to rent in the UK.

What is a roommate rental agreement?

A room rental agreement (“roommate agreement”) is a legal contract used between two or more tenants to sublet a rental property’s bedrooms while sharing its common (communal) areas. These tenants, often referred to as cotenants, are liable to each other for the rent, utilities and other agreed-upon charges related to the property.

What is a rent agreement?

Rental Agreement. A rental agreement is similar to a lease agreement, but only provides for use of the property for a short period of time. Where a lease agreement for real property, such as a home, is commonly signed for a period of six months to one year or more, a rental agreement is usually only valid for 30 days.
